Benefits of Using Cake Mix Doctor Recipes
There are several benefits to using cake mix doctor recipes:
1. Convenience
One of the primary advantages of cake mix doctor recipes is their convenience. By using a store-bought cake mix as a base, bakers can save time and effort in measuring and mixing ingredients. This makes it an ideal choice for busy individuals or those who are new to baking.
2. Cost-Effective
Using cake mix doctor recipes can also be cost-effective. Cake mixes are often more affordable than purchasing all the ingredients separately. Additionally, many bakers already have some of the necessary ingredients on hand, further reducing costs.
3. Flexibility
Cake mix doctor recipes offer flexibility in terms of flavor and texture. Bakers can experiment with various ingredients and techniques to create unique and personalized cakes. This allows for endless possibilities and ensures that every cake is a unique creation.

Tips for Success
To ensure the best results when using cake mix doctor recipes, here are some tips to keep in mind:
1. Follow the Instructions
Always follow the instructions provided in the cake mix doctor recipe. This includes measuring ingredients accurately and following the mixing and baking times.
2. Use Quality Ingredients
The quality of the ingredients you use can greatly impact the final outcome. Opt for fresh, high-quality ingredients whenever possible.
3. Experiment with Flavors
Don’t be afraid to experiment with different flavors and ingredients. Adding extracts, spices, or even fresh fruits can elevate the taste of your cake.
4. Practice Patience
Baking requires patience. Allow your cake to cool completely before frosting or serving, as this will ensure the best texture and taste.
